Beautiful authentic accommodation in prime location, but noisy

Tucked in the narrow cobbled streets of Granada, almost at the foot of the Alhambra, this is a beautiful and authentic hotel.

The breakfast is fantastic and fresh, and runs until midday which is great. There is good access to the internet and printer which is very useful.

However, we stayed in a room on the top floor and it really did feel like we were sharing our room with the guests to our left and right. Part of staying in a beautiful old building is accepting the lesser degree of sound insulation, but this was excessively noisy - we could easily hear the conversations, televisions, bathroom visits and entertainment of those around us... as if they were happening in our room. This was at all hours, well after midnight and well before 7am, impacting on our stay appreciably. I don't think that this is as much of a problem in the lower rooms so would recommend requesting a room that isn't top floor.

The staff were pleasant and, aside for the interruptions from other guests, it was an enjoyable stay. I'm not sure I would return, however, absent a guarantee of a quieter room.

This is a great hotel. Tucked away in a quiet street off of the Plaza Nueva it’s a little haven of peace with full access to the city’s activities. The room was simple, the beds aren't great, but the hotel has a comfortable living room with a public computer, and a lovely courtyard typical of the regional architecture. Perhaps the hotel’s best asset, however, is the receptionist (I believe her name is Paola). She was friendly and helpful, and did all she could to help weary travelers have as comfortable a stay as possible (made calls for us, clearly explained directions, etc.).

Note – if you drive and park in the recommended garage, prepare yourself for one of the worst parking garage experiences of your life. The spaces are really tight – we were not the only ones who tried to fit into several different spaces. Ultimately, we parked, and the cab ride to the hotel was short. Overnight parking in the garage, with the hotel discount (pay at the hotel and they give you a voucher), costs about 15 euros.

This is a beautiful hotel, tucked away behind Plaza Nueva and only 20 minutes from the Alhambra. A converted 17th century garrison, it has been refurbished with style and simplicity. The hotel was lovely and cool during the heat of August and the staff were very helpful and friendly. Rooms were spotless and came with a mini-bar and the breakfast was very good. The only down point would be that the room was quite dark, but then this helped to keep it cool, so I suppose you can't have everything. Most rooms looked into the courtyard, so you couldn't open your curtains otherwise people walking past could see in. I would recommend getting a room with an outward view. Even so, I would stay here again and recommend it to anyone.
